Understanding Car Key Types
Before diving into replacement services, it's important to comprehend the various types of car keys that exist. Each type of key includes its own replacement procedure, functions, and costs.
Key Types:
Traditional Keys:
Standard metal keys that do not consist of electronic components.Easy to change and normally cheaper.
Transponder Keys:
Contain an electronic chip that interacts with the car's ignition.More protected than traditional keys, making them slightly more costly to replace.
Smart Keys:
Used in keyless entry systems. They typically feature buttons for remote locking/unlocking.Replacement can be made complex and expensive due to the innovation included.
Key Fobs:

A number of situations can cause the requirement for a replacement car key:

The cost to replace a car key can differ considerably based upon numerous aspects:

A1: Yes, lots of locksmiths can replace car keys without the need to check out a dealership.
Q2: How long does it take to get a replacement key?
A2: Depending on the kind of key and the service supplier, it can take anywhere from a couple of minutes to several days.
Q3: Do I need to offer my vehicle identification number (VIN)?
A3: Yes, offering your VIN helps make sure that the replacement key is compatible with your vehicle.
Q4: Are lost car key insurance plan worth considering?
A4: If losing keys is a persistent concern for you, it may be rewarding to explore insurance coverage options that cover key replacement costs.
